Chlorine has an atomic number of 17. Chlorine-35 and chlorine-37 are two isotopes of chlorine. Complete the table to show the numbers of protons, neutrons and elect... show full transcript

For both isotopes, chlorine has an atomic number of 17, which means the number of protons is 17 for both chlorine-35 and chlorine-37.

To find the number of neutrons, subtract the atomic number from the mass number.

  • For chlorine-35:

    3517=1835 - 17 = 18

  • For chlorine-37:

    3717=2037 - 17 = 20

Thus, chlorine-35 has 18 neutrons, and chlorine-37 has 20 neutrons.

Since chlorine is neutral in both isotopes, the number of electrons equals the number of protons. Therefore, both chlorine-35 and chlorine-37 have 17 electrons.
